The Truth About Paid Surveys in 2025
Paid surveys can be a legitimate way to earn extra money, but it's important to have realistic expectations. While you won't get rich from surveys, you can earn $200-500 per month if you're strategic about which sites you use and how you approach survey taking. The key is understanding which surveys pay the most, how to qualify for premium opportunities, and avoiding the many scam sites in this space.
What You Need to Know Before Starting
- • Survey income is highly variable and unpredictable
- • Your demographics significantly affect earning potential
- • Most surveys pay $0.25-2.00 and take 5-20 minutes
- • You'll be disqualified from 30-70% of surveys
- • Patience and persistence are essential for success
- • Never pay to join a survey site - all legitimate sites are free

Strategies to Maximize Your Survey Earnings
🎯 Profile Optimization
Your demographics profile is crucial for survey qualification. Companies pay more for specific target audiences:
- • Age 25-54: Prime consumer demographic
- • Household income $50K+: Higher purchasing power
- • Parents: Many surveys target family decision-makers
- • Homeowners: Qualify for home improvement surveys
- • Business professionals: B2B survey opportunities
- • Healthcare workers: Medical research surveys
📱 Multi-Platform Strategy
Start with 3-5 Sites
Begin with Swagbucks, Survey Junkie, and InboxDollars to learn the ropes without overwhelming yourself.
Expand Gradually
Add 1-2 new sites per month until you have 8-10 active memberships for maximum survey availability.
Track Performance
Keep a spreadsheet tracking earnings per site to identify your most profitable platforms.
⏱️ Time Management
- • Check multiple sites daily: New surveys appear throughout the day
- • Set aside dedicated time: 30-60 minutes of focused survey time is more effective than scattered attempts
- • Use mobile apps: Complete short surveys during commutes or waiting periods
- • Weekend surveys: Often pay more due to lower participation
- • End-of-month rushes: Companies often have budget to spend before month-end
💡 Advanced Tips
- • Answer honestly: Inconsistent answers lead to disqualification
- • Complete profiles fully: Detailed profiles lead to better survey matches
- • Don't speed through: Quality responses lead to more invitations
- • Check email regularly: High-paying surveys often come via email invitation
- • Join panel discussions: Focus groups pay $50-200 but are rare
- • Product testing: Keep physical products plus payment
Survey Scams to Avoid
🚨 Major Red Flags
- • Asking for money upfront: Legitimate sites NEVER charge fees
- • Promising unrealistic earnings: Claims of $100+ per day from surveys
- • Requesting sensitive information: SSN, bank account details, or passwords
- • No contact information: No physical address or customer service
- • Poor website quality: Typos, broken links, or unprofessional design
- • Spam-heavy email lists: Excessive promotional emails
Common Scam Types
Fake Survey Sites
Sites that collect your information but never pay. Always research sites before joining.
Pyramid Schemes
Sites requiring recruitment of friends to earn. Focus on legitimate survey work instead.
Identity Theft
Fake sites designed to steal personal information. Never provide SSN or financial details.
How to Verify Legitimacy
Research First
Google "[site name] reviews" and "[site name] scam" to see user experiences.
Check Better Business Bureau
Look up company ratings and complaint history on BBB.org.
Test Small First
Complete a few surveys and attempt a small cashout before investing significant time.
Tax Implications of Survey Income
Reporting Requirements
When You'll Receive 1099 Forms
- • $600+ from any single site in a tax year
- • Forms typically arrive by January 31
- • Report ALL income, even without 1099
- • Include cash AND gift card value
Record Keeping
- • Track all payments from each site
- • Screenshot payment confirmations
- • Keep records of business expenses
- • Maintain organized files by tax year
Deductible Expenses
Possible Deductions
- • Internet costs (business portion)
- • Computer equipment used for surveys
- • Home office space (if dedicated)
- • Software and apps for tracking
Tax Strategy Tips
- • Consult a tax professional
- • Consider quarterly estimated payments
- • Track expenses throughout the year
- • Separate business and personal use
Setting Realistic Expectations
What Survey Income IS Good For
- • Extra spending money: $50-200 per month for hobbies
- • Emergency fund building: Small but consistent contributions
- • Gift money: Earning gift cards for holidays
- • Flexible side income: Work around your schedule
- • Learning experience: Understanding market research
- • No skill barrier: Anyone can participate
What Survey Income Is NOT
- • A full-time income: Cannot replace a job
- • Get-rich-quick scheme: Earnings are modest
- • Guaranteed income: Highly variable month to month
- • Career building: No advancement opportunities
- • High hourly rate: Often below minimum wage
- • Passive income: Requires active time investment
Monthly Earning Breakdown by Effort Level
Casual (30 min/day)
$50-100
3-4 sites, basic surveys
Dedicated (1-2 hours/day)
$150-300
8-10 sites, focus groups
Intensive (3+ hours/day)
$300-500
10+ sites, premium opportunities
